リモート・イシュミック・コンディショニングは,アントラサイクリンによる心臓毒性に対して,その抗腫瘍活性を損なうことなく保護します

まとめ
リモート・イシェミック・コンディショニング (RIC) は,がん治療の有効性を低下させることなく,化学療法による心臓毒性から心臓を保護します. このシンプルで非薬学的な戦略は,がん治療中に患者の生活の質を向上させることを約束しています.

背景:
- アンスラサイクリン (Anthracycline) は,がんに対する重要な薬ですが,心臓毒性を引き起こし,その使用を制限します.
- アントラサイクリン誘発性心臓毒性 (AIC) を予防するための効果的な戦略はほとんど存在しない.
- リモート・イシュケミア・コンディショニング (RIC) は,心臓保護の有望性を示しているが,腫瘍反応への影響は不明である.
研究 の 目的:
- RICがAICに対して,腫瘍を有するマウスモデルで保護するかどうかを調査する.
- ドクソルビシンに対する心臓機能と腫瘍の反応の両方にRICの影響を評価する.
- RICがドクソルビシンの抗腫瘍効果を損なうかどうかを判断する.
主な方法:
- 皮膚腫瘍は,DMBA/TPAを使用したマウスで誘発された.
- マウスは,毎週RICを併用または併用せずにドクソルビシン化学療法を受けた.
- 心臓の機能はエコーカルディオグラフィーで評価され,腫瘍の成長と生存率はモニタリングされました.
主要な成果:
- ドクソルビシンは心臓機能障害を誘発し,生存率を低下させ,腫瘍の成長を抑制した.
- RICは心臓機能を保ち,生存率の向上に向けた傾向を示した.
- RICはドクソルビシンの抗腫瘍効果を弱めず,同様の腫瘍抑制を図った.
結論:
- RICは,腫瘍を患ったマウスのアントラサイクリン化学療法中に心臓機能を保ちます.
- RICは,化学療法の有効性を損なうことなく,AICを軽減するための安全で低コストの戦略です.
- RICは,腫瘍学患者のアウトカムを改善するための潜在的翻訳的関連性を持っています.

In power systems, the entire setup is divided into protective zones to isolate faults and protect the rest of the network. These zones include generators, transformers, buses, transmission lines, distribution lines, and motors. Each zone can be visualized as a separate room in a house, with each room protected by its own circuit breaker.

Radial systems employ time-delay overcurrent relays to reduce load interruptions. When a fault occurs, the nearest breaker opens first, while upstream breakers remain closed due to longer delay settings. This approach ensures minimal disruption to the rest of the system.

Coordinating time-delay overcurrent relays in complex radial systems and directional overcurrent relays in multi-source transmission loops can be challenging. Impedance relays address these issues by responding to the voltage-to-current ratio, specifically measuring the apparent impedance of a line. These relays become more sensitive during faults as current increases and voltage decreases, thereby reducing the apparent impedance.

Personal protective equipment (PPE) is unique clothing or equipment worn by an employee to minimize or prevent exposure to infectious agents. PPE creates a barrier between the employee and the infectious materials. PPE must be readily available in the patient care area.
